So, 'Las Vegas: An Unconventional History: Part 2 - American Mecca' dives deeper into the chaotic, colorful tapestry of Vegas's evolution. It captures that mix of grit and glamour, exploring how a barren desert transformed into a bustling hub. The pacing has this rhythmic quality; it ebbs and flows as it reveals layers of history, from the mob's influence to the rise of mega-casinos. The interviews and archival footage lend an authenticity that really grounds the narrative. It’s not just about the lights and shows but the people and events that shaped it. There’s a certain nostalgia, a bittersweet reflection on the American Dream, which resonates throughout. Overall, it’s an intriguing piece for anyone interested in the roots of this odd oasis in the desert.
